WebUnfair contract terms and small businesses. A law protecting small businesses from unfair contract terms in standard form contracts applies to contracts entered into or renewed on or after 12 November 2016, where: the price of the contract is no more than $300,000 or $1 million if the contract is for more than 12 months. A contract can be: Unilateral — where it is a promise … hawaii gathering place word cross clueWebDec 3, 2024 · Contract rescission is the legal term used when a contract is terminated or cancelled. It may also be called “overturning” or “cancellation” of a contract. Contract rescission ends the contract. Often, this also cancels any of the legal responsibilities that were in the contract.
